# Runbook: Account Recovery — Splitstone Assignment Service

If the admin account for Splitstone is locked, do not reseed experiments; assignments are deterministic and must not shift mid-test. Instead, restore the operator session through the offline console. The console prompts once, and accepts only the recovery passphrase recorded directly below.

strongbox words: zorwyn-sorael-belion-ulaius-silmir-ulays-briax-rusdor-gorix

# Build Provenance: DeployDrake Chat Bot

DeployDrake, the bot that posts deploy status into the Foxhollow eng channel, is now built exclusively on the Lanternworks hermetic pipeline. Each release embeds its source revision, builder identity, and a signed attestation from the Corvid signing service. For this week's sync, please verify your local install against the token recorded directly below this line.

trace token, fafog-kageg: htk4_98e6

## Cutover: monthly partitions

Heads up, plugin folks: Ledgerbee's events table is now partitioned by month. Your queries should always filter on event_month or you'll scan everything and make the Tuneville ops crew sad. New partitions are created automatically a week ahead. To publish a compatible plugin build, sign your package with the deploy key provided here.

deploy key for kajof-fajop: bky6_gDHw9Q

Subject: Key rotation — catalog cache invalidation

Team,

The Shelfdex invalidation worker's key was rotated today. Old key stops working Friday. The worker purges stale catalog entries from the Pricegrove cache on product updates; if it stalls, listings go stale. Update your local configs. The new key for the invalidation service follows below.

API key for yahig-tadup: kto7_ubizbYm

## Changelog — Mistlefen reminder job, v4.2

Defaults changed. Reminder window moved from 48h to 24h before appointment. Retry count dropped from 5 to 3; SMS fallback now off by default after the duplicate-message incident at the Harrowick clinic. Quiet hours extended to 21:00–08:00. Batch size halved to reduce queue pressure. On-call: if reminders stall, restart the dispatcher before escalating. No schema changes. Effective next deploy. Current defaults shipped with this release are listed below.

service settings:
novath:
  pin: 1396
  tenant: pelys
  seal: seal_ccc035e1
  metrics_host: metrics.novath.qorvelworks.test
  standby_team: fraeth
  escalation: drueth-zorok
  nonce: 61d508